Full Frame Replacement

A Full Frame Replacement means removing the entire existing window, frame and all, down to the rough opening, then installing a completely new unit with fresh framing, flashing, and insulation. You need this when the frame itself is compromised: rotted wood, warped aluminum, or sills that have started to pull away from the stucco. In Fountainebleau, we regularly see full frame jobs where decades of driving rain and salt exposure have eaten through the original builder-grade frames. Winslow handles the whole process, including hauling the old units away and properly sealing the new frame against the elements.

Insert Window Replacement

Insert Window Replacement, sometimes called pocket replacement, fits a new window unit inside the existing frame when that frame is still square, solid, and structurally sound. It’s faster and less invasive than full frame work, which makes it a good fit for Fountainebleau homeowners whose frames are in decent shape but whose glass, seals, or hardware have failed. We measure the existing opening precisely, order the unit to spec, and install it with the same flashing and sealing standards we use on full replacements. If we find hidden damage once the old sash comes out, we’ll tell you before going further, not after the invoice is written.

Energy-Efficient Upgrade

An Energy-Efficient Upgrade is really about the glass package: Low-E coatings that reflect heat while letting light through, double or triple panes with insulating gas between them, and warm-edge spacers that reduce condensation at the edges. In Fountainebleau, where air conditioning runs most of the year, upgrading to energy-rated units can cut cooling costs and, just as importantly, reduce the hot spots and glare that make certain rooms uncomfortable by mid-afternoon. We’ll show you the difference between glass packages in real dollars and help you choose the one that pays for itself fastest.

Signs You Need Window Replacement Right Now

Some window problems announce themselves with a crash. Most don’t. They build up slowly until one day you realize you’ve been living with a draft for three years or propping a window shut with a paint stirrer. Here are the signals Fountainebleau homeowners call us about most often.

  • Condensation trapped between the panes. That fog isn’t on the glass; it’s inside the sealed unit, which means the seal has failed and the insulating gas has escaped. The window’s energy performance is now roughly equal to a single pane, and the only real fix is a new unit.
  • Windows that stick, jam, or won’t stay open. In our humidity, frames and balances wear out faster than they would up north. A window that won’t open isn’t just annoying; it’s a safety issue if that window is your fire escape route from a bedroom.
  • You can feel air moving around a closed window. Run your hand around the perimeter on a breezy day. If you feel airflow, the weatherstripping or the frame seal has failed, and you’re paying to cool outside air every month.
  • Soft spots or visible rot in wood frames. In Fountainebleau’s wet, warm climate, wood rot moves fast once it starts. A soft sill today becomes a structural problem, and a water intrusion problem, much sooner than you’d think.
  • Your energy bills keep climbing without an obvious reason. Windows built before modern Low-E standards lose a significant amount of conditioned air. If your AC runs constantly and certain rooms stay warm all summer, the glass is a likely culprit.

How Much Does Window Replacement Cost in Fountainebleau?

A typical insert window replacement in Fountainebleau runs between $650 and $1,200 per window, while full frame replacements run from $1,000 to $1,850 per window. A standard three-bedroom home with 12 to 15 windows will usually land between $9,000 and $18,000 total, with impact-rated glass adding 35 to 50 percent to the material cost. Energy-efficient upgrades are often a modest add-on to either of those numbers, typically $60 to $150 per window depending on the glass package. Vinyl replacement windows sit at the lower end of the range; impact-rated aluminum or custom sizes land at the top.

What moves the price most is the glass package, the frame material, the size of the opening, and whether the existing frame can accept an insert or needs full replacement. Access also matters: second-story windows, tight side yards, and stucco repairs all add labor hours. The way to avoid overpaying is to get a line-item quote, compare actual specifications against actual specifications, and not to pay for a window rating you don’t need.
